Help is a short and simple word. But, that doesn’t mean it’s short or simple to get help.
As a licensed clinician since 2000, I understand that that therapy is not a one size fits all. And that help and growing oneself is a process that is unique to each individual. We cannot truly know what that process will be in advance but we can come to see and understand it, by having an experience with it.
Over the course of my career, I’ve worked in several community and two hospital settings. I have worked with people struggling with issues with substance, abuse, loss, divorce, and those wishing to understand themselves better.
In 2015 I completed a comprehensive advanced training program that lead to my credential in adult psychoanalysis.
At bottom, my clinical work is founded and fueled by my respect and compassion for all forms of human suffering. As human beings we are each so complex. We know ourselves and yet also don’t or cannot always know ourselves. In a similar way, our unconscious can also provide clues to solving the issues that lead us to psychotherapy. In this way, part of therapy is about having a safe space and time to find more awareness and acceptance for oneself.
